SDF is looking for an Account Manager to manage and grow our diverse infrastructure partnerships within the Business Development team. These partners include RPC node providers, validators, identity verification services, indexers, and analytics firms that power dashboards, market and trading data, and compliance and risk analytics for both internal and external stakeholders.
Infrastructure partnerships are critical to the Stellar ecosystem - they are what developers and builders rely on to ensure a robust, secure, and performant blockchain environment. In this role, you'll engage deeply with these providers, developing a thorough understanding of their capabilities, identifying gaps, and uncovering opportunities to expand relationships as the blockchain landscape continues to evolve. What you’ll do:
- Manage a portfolio of infrastructure partnerships across RPC node providers, validators, indexers, analytics providers, and compliance/risk data vendors — serving as the primary point of contact and relationship owner for each.
- Develop deep familiarity with each partner's technical capabilities, roadmap, and service offerings, and translate that knowledge into actionable insights for internal SDF teams including engineering, product, and ecosystem.
- Conduct regular partner reviews to assess performance, surface gaps in coverage or capability, and identify areas where partners can expand their footprint within the Stellar ecosystem.
- Drive expansion of partner relationships by identifying new use cases, advocating for Stellar integrations, and coordinating with BD leadership on commercial terms or grant structures where applicable.
- Monitor the health of the infrastructure ecosystem, flagging risks such as validator concentration, data provider outages, or indexer coverage gaps, and working proactively with partners to resolve them.
- Collaborate cross-functionally with SDF's product, engineering, and developer relations teams to ensure partner capabilities align with the evolving needs of builders on the Stellar network.
- Support onboarding of new infrastructure partners, including scoping integration requirements, coordinating technical introductions, and tracking progress through to launch.
- Maintain accurate and up-to-date records of partner status, communications, and pipeline activity in CRM systems; provide regular reporting to BD leadership on portfolio health.
- Stay current on trends in blockchain infrastructure — including developments in data availability, node infrastructure, on-chain analytics, and compliance tooling — and bring relevant insights back to internal teams.
- Represent SDF at industry events and partner meetings, building relationships across the infrastructure provider community and positioning SDF as a thoughtful and engaged foundation partner.

About Stellar
Stellar is more than a blockchain. Powered by a decentralized, fast, scalable, and uniquely sustainable network made for financial products and services and a thriving and passionate ecosystem that includes a non-profit organization driven by a mission, Stellar is paving the path to unlock the world’s economic potential through blockchain technology. Built with speed and low costs in mind, the Stellar network provides builders and financial institutions worldwide a platform to issue assets, and to send and convert currencies in real time creating real world utility. Founded in 2014, the Stellar Development Foundation (SDF) supports the continued development and growth of the Stellar network and also serves the ecosystem of NGOs, corporations, universities, small businesses, governments, and solo entrepreneurs building on the Stellar network through tooling, funding and strategic collaborations. About the Stellar Development Foundation
The Stellar Development Foundation (SDF) is a non-profit organization focused on working with and supporting change-makers to create equitable access to the global financial system through blockchain technology. SDF provides grants, investments, funding, and other awards to builders and organizations. SDF also develops resources and tooling on the Stellar network to help unlock real world utility. As a nonprofit foundation, SDF puts the health of the Stellar network and the Stellar ecosystem and its mission above all else.
